Transaction 439ea21f053208708c76fff89dee13af903fcfdc35275fd2a834855db3a69415

1 Input
2 Outputs
  • 439ea21f053208708c76fff89dee13af903fcfdc35275fd2a834855db3a69415:0
  • value  1237589
    address  3ABpUqLxnfAm1KEaz9tPW5tFRLHmzhrw8T
  • 439ea21f053208708c76fff89dee13af903fcfdc35275fd2a834855db3a69415:1
  • value  133393482
    address  338tPRse3itpWbgiHrZbzjGYoyUUJw2ZhQ